Moroka Swallows release defender Tsietsi Mahoa

Mahoa started 14 games last season for Swallows – 12 of which came in the opening 14 League matches – and then disappeared when Shere Lekgothoane eventually became the preferred choice at left-back.

snl24.com/kickoff has since established that Mahoa and his handlers have since been informed that the club will not be taking up the option of another year on his contract.

This development effectively means that the 32-year-old will be free next month.

With Swallows relegated to the National First Division, the club is faced up with the challenge of a major overhaul which will be necessitated by the budgetary constraints and age-limit rules in the second tier.

The club has already indicated that they will not be retaining Mthokozisi Yende, while Vuyisile Wana and Lantshene Phalane have joined Bloemfontein Celtic.
